Tool Development : Interfaces are high mileage

I've written a large number of tools that end up deprecated.  Often times the content creation app will offer a more elegant native solution in an update, or more commonly, the pipeline needs itself changes.

Interfaces however, are much more resilient and surprisingly high mileage.  

I've built many one off animations rigs that languish, while the keyframe tool that drives it continues to find usage.  The animation UI pictured for simple commands such as zeroing out, mirroring and keying poses have been adapted to numerous foreign rigs on a number of various contracts and small side projects.
